迷宫题目解答题及答案.docVIP

  • 1
  • 0
  • 约3.16千字
  • 约 12页
  • 2025-10-18 发布于辽宁
  • 举报

迷宫题目解答题及答案

一、单项选择题(总共10题,每题2分)

1.在迷宫问题中,以下哪种搜索算法优先考虑最近的目标节点?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.次优优先搜索

答案:C

2.在迷宫问题中,深度优先搜索通常使用哪种数据结构来实现?

A.队列

B.栈

C.链表

D.树

答案:B

3.在迷宫问题中,广度优先搜索的时间复杂度通常是多少?

A.O(n)

B.O(n^2)

C.O(n^3)

D.O(2^n)

答案:B

4.在迷宫问题中,最佳优先搜索通常使用哪种启发式函数?

A.距离目标节点的曼哈顿距离

B.距离目标节点的欧几里得距离

C.节点的访问次数

D.节点的深度

答案:A

5.在迷宫问题中,以下哪种搜索算法可能会陷入无限循环?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都可能

答案:D

6.在迷宫问题中,以下哪种搜索算法能够保证找到最短路径?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都能保证

答案:B

7.在迷宫问题中,以下哪种搜索算法不需要存储所有已访问的节点?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都不需要

答案:C

8.在迷宫问题中,以下哪种搜索算法适用于大型迷宫?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都适用

答案:C

9.在迷宫问题中,以下哪种搜索算法适用于小型迷宫?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都适用

答案:A

10.在迷宫问题中,以下哪种搜索算法能够避免重复访问节点?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都能避免

答案:B

二、多项选择题(总共10题,每题2分)

1.在迷宫问题中,以下哪些搜索算法是盲目搜索?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都是

答案:D

2.在迷宫问题中,以下哪些搜索算法需要存储已访问的节点?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都需要

答案:D

3.在迷宫问题中,以下哪些搜索算法可以使用启发式函数?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和C都可以

答案:C

4.在迷宫问题中,以下哪些搜索算法适用于无权图?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都适用

答案:D

5.在迷宫问题中,以下哪些搜索算法适用于有权图?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和C都适用

答案:C

6.在迷宫问题中,以下哪些搜索算法能够找到多条路径?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都能找到

答案:A

7.在迷宫问题中,以下哪些搜索算法能够避免陷入无限循环?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都能避免

答案:B

8.在迷宫问题中,以下哪些搜索算法适用于动态迷宫?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都适用

答案:C

9.在迷宫问题中,以下哪些搜索算法适用于静态迷宫?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都适用

答案:D

10.在迷宫问题中,以下哪些搜索算法能够保证找到路径?

A.深度优先搜索

B.广度优先搜索

C.最佳优先搜索

D.A和B都能保证

答案:B

三、判断题(总共10题,每题2分)

1.在迷宫问题中,深度优先搜索总是能够找到最短路径。

答案:错误

2.在迷宫问题中,广度优先搜索总是能够找到路径。

答案:正确

3.在迷宫问题中,最佳优先搜索总是能够找到最短路径。

答案:正确

4.在迷宫问题中,深度优先搜索可能会陷入无限循环。

答案:正确

5.在迷宫问题中,广度优先搜索可能会陷入无限循环。

答案:错误

6.在迷宫问题中,最佳优先搜索可能会陷入无限循环。

答案:错误

7.在迷宫问题中,深度优先搜索不需要存储所有已访问的节点。

答案:正确

8.在迷宫问题中,广度优先搜索不需要存储所有已访问的节点。

答案:错误

9.在迷宫问题中,最佳优先搜索不需要存储所有已访问的节点。

答案:正确

10.在迷宫问题中,深度优先搜索适用于大型迷宫。

答案:错误

四、简答题(总共4题,每题5分)

1.简述深度优先搜索在迷宫问题中的工作原理。

答案:深度优先搜索是一种盲目搜索算法,它从起点开始,沿着一条路径不断深入探索,直到无法继续前进或者找到目标节点。在探索过程中,深度优先搜索使用栈来存

文档评论(0)

1亿VIP精品文档

相关文档